Key Features
- 【Reliable External Storage System for Individuals and business】The 3.5 hard drive enclosure supports 2.5/3.5 inches HDD and SSD, max capacity up to 20TB for each hard drive, it's a ideal external hard drive enclosure for personal or enterprise using.Save space on your desktop or laptop.
- 【No heat】The sata enclosure built in Aluminum-Alloy materials and 2.7 inch Fan.Maximize the security of your data. NOTE:Fan noise is around 40-50 decibels, not recommended if you are very sensitive to noise.
- 【Up to 5Gbps】This 3.5 hard drive enclosure equips with advanced chips and USB 3.0 output interface.Transfer 1G files in 3-5 seconds with USB 3.0 Ports, which is 10 times faster than USB 2.0.
- 【Hot Swappable Convenience】The HDD enclosure supports hot swapping, allowing users to replace hard drives without powering off the device. This feature enhances convenience and efficiency in data transfer processes.
- 【Tool-Free Installation】Featuring a tool-free hard drive tray design, the external hard drive enclosure enables easy installation and removal of hard drives without requiring additional tools. Plug and play! No fuss, no muss!
- 【Daisy Chain Expansion】Add a USB HOST port for external hard drive enclosure and daisy chain to expand capacity. Expansion 180TB storage through daisy chain up to 3 devices
